unpredictable
adjective as in changeable
Strongest matches
Weak matches
capricious, chance, chancy, dicey, doubtful, fluctuating, fluky, from left field, hanging by a thread, iffy, incalculable, inconstant, random, touch and go, touchy, unforeseeable, up for grabs, variable, whimsical
